A mesothelioma lawyer can help you file a lawsuit against negligent asbestos product manufacturers. These lawsuits could give victims compensation to cover their medical expenses along with lost wages, and other losses. Additionally, families of deceased victims can file wrongful death lawsuits against the asbestos companies responsible for the deaths of their loved ones.

Each mesothelioma case is different however there are a few important elements that determine how much a victim's compensation should be. These factors include the type of mesothelioma they suffer, their level of exposure to asbestos, and how long they've been diagnosed. In their free consultation, a mesothelioma attorney can assist you in estimating the value of your claim based on these criteria.

Another important aspect to consider is how much time you have left to file a mesothelioma lawsuit. Each state has its own statute of limitations that limits the time that you must file your claim after mesothelioma diagnosis.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you understand the deadlines in your state so that you can file your claim before they expire.

In addition to mesothelioma lawsuits, a lawyer can assist in other types of personal injury claims, including asbestos lawsuits asbestos trust fund claims, and wrongful death lawsuits. The wrongful death lawsuits are brought by relatives following the loss of a loved one due to mesothelioma or an asbestos-related illness. A wrongful death lawsuit can cover funeral costs, loss of consortium and suffering and suffering as well as other financial losses.

In most states, plaintiffs have between two and four years to bring civil lawsuits to seek monetary compensation. This time limit starts to run when a person is diagnosed with mesothelioma.
